22213130323 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 22213130324. Its totient is φ = 22213130322.
The previous prime is 22213130311. The next prime is 22213130333. The reversal of 22213130323 is 32303131222.
It is a strong prime.
It is a cyclic number.
It is a de Polignac number, because none of the positive numbers 2k-22213130323 is a prime.
It is a junction number, because it is equal to n+sod(n) for n = 22213130294 and 22213130303.
It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(22213130333)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 11106565161 + 11106565162.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(11106565162).
Almost surely, 222213130323 is an apocalyptic number.
22213130323 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).
22213130323 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
22213130323 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 1296, while the sum is 22.
Adding to 22213130323 its reverse (32303131222), we get a palindrome (54516261545).
